New Aurora church enrolls first new members

Flowing Forth United Methodist Church in Aurora, formed in October, welcomed its first new members April 28.

During worship services, the Rev. Derek Rogers introduced new members to the congregation.

Welcomed were Breann Rogers, North Aurora; Mark Lindsay, Aurora; and Ruth and Jeff Butler, North Aurora. The Butlers' sons, Cole, Graham and Quinn, accompanied their parents.

New members completed a class led by Rev. Rogers to qualify for membership.

Flowing Forth UMC was formed in October after a merger of the former historic Fourth Street UMC and Flowing Grace UMC, both in Aurora.
